Key Questions Answered

What is the purpose of NVIDIA DeepStream SDK?
The NVIDIA DeepStream SDK is designed to enable developers to create real-time streaming analytics applications using NVIDIA GPUs. It supports various use cases such as smart retail, traffic planning, and warehouse management, providing a scalable framework for Intelligent Video Analytics.
How can developers get started with DeepStream on Azure?
Developers can start by running a sample application on GitHub that integrates DeepStream with Azure IoT Edge. This allows them to quickly deploy IoT applications and gain insights from real-time data analytics.
What types of devices can run DeepStream SDK?
DeepStream SDK can be deployed on various devices, including the NVIDIA Jetson Nano, which delivers up to 0.5 TFLOPS, and NVIDIA T4 servers, which provide over 10,000 TOPS, making it suitable for a range of edge computing applications.

Key Actionable Insights

1
Developers should leverage the DeepStream SDK to build scalable IoT applications that can analyze video streams in real-time. This capability is crucial for industries that rely on immediate data insights for operational efficiency.
By integrating DeepStream with Azure IoT Hub, developers can send data from edge devices to the cloud, enabling advanced analytics and decision-making processes.
2
Utilizing the NVIDIA Jetson Nano for deploying DeepStream applications can significantly reduce power consumption while maintaining high performance. This is particularly beneficial for edge devices in remote locations.
The Jetson Nano's ability to perform 0.5 TFLOPS in under 10 watts makes it an ideal choice for energy-efficient IoT solutions.
